1. Themed Google Ads
The holiday season is a great time to put out ads that have the added benefit of a holiday theme to add some pizazz and help them stand out. With many people spending extra time online shopping for gifts you can extend your audience reach and benefit from increased traffic. 2. Holiday Social Media Giveaway
Giveaways are a great low-cost method to increase engagement and grow your total follower count. Having users like, comment, and share your post can lead to organic reach and even increased traffic to your website if you have a link. 3. Holiday-Themed Email Blasts
Send marketing emails to your patients this season that offer tips for hearing health through the holidays. Remind people to book an appointment before the end of the year, and thank them for their loyalty while wishing them a happy holiday season! If you have any sort of promotion or sale going on, emails are a great way to promote your sale in a way that people can easily forward to others.
4. Themed Direct Mail
A personalized holiday-themed greeting card wishing your patients a Merry Christmas or Happy New Year is a great way to keep in touch. You can also include a reminder to schedule a yearly appointment, just in time to be on people’s New Years Resolutions lists.

5. End of Season Sale
Entice bargain shoppers and those still on the hunt for seasonal promotions. While Black Friday might be over, shoppers will still be looking for savings. According to LocaliQ, One-third of consumers say their holiday weekend spending is driven by holiday promotions.1 You could also consider offering a “free gift with purchase” to add value to already existing sales.

7. Gift Cards
Everyone has someone in their life who is impossible to think of gifts for! Gift cards are a great option for the person who already has everything! You could also consider offering gift cards for a certain amount or percentage off for customers who bring in referrals. According to the NRF and Prosper Insights & Analytics October 2021 Consumer Holiday Survey, a whopping 56% of consumers listed gift cards as the top gift they would like to receive this holiday season. 2
8. Holiday-Themed Video
Video marketing lets your patients get to know you on a more personal level. Take this time to thank your patients with a positive message. Make sure to showcase your office and show off any holiday decorations you have up. This is also a great way to give people a feeling of your overall brand, not just the products or services that you offer.
